Mastering Map Control in CS2: Tips and Techniques for Dominating Every Match
Mastering map control in CS2 is crucial for any player looking to dominate each match. Understanding the layout of each map, including chokepoints, high ground positions, and common hiding spots, allows players to establish strategic advantages over their opponents. Start by regularly practicing position-based gameplay—spending time in training maps can help you learn the intricacies of movement and angles. Consider these tips:
- Familiarize yourself with the map layout.
- Control critical areas early in the round.
- Communicate with your team to coordinate efforts.
Utilizing smokes and flashes effectively can also enhance your control over critical map locations. Timing your utility usage is key; throwing a smoke grenade to block enemy sightlines or using a flashbang to blind opponents can create openings for your team. Moreover, adapting your strategy based on the evolving dynamics of the match is essential. Develop a habit of constantly assessing your positioning and that of your teammates. Remember, the team that masters map control and coordinates well tends to dominate, so always aim for collaboration in your gameplay.

Common Map Layouts in CS2: Strategies for Each Location
In CS2, understanding the layout of each map is crucial for developing effective strategies. Common map layouts include the classic modes like Dust II, Inferno, and Mirage. Each location presents unique challenges and opportunities. For instance, on Dust II, players should utilize its long sightlines to engage enemies efficiently, while on Inferno, controlling the tight spaces of Banana can provide a significant tactical advantage. Here are some recommended strategies for these maps:
- Dust II: Leverage A long control, flank strategies from the T side, and coordinate smoke and flashbang usage.
- Inferno: Emphasize teamwork to take control of Mid, and utilize utility to clear corners before engaging.
Another popular map, Mirage, is known for its balanced layout, offering both open and enclosed spaces. Here, players should focus on site takes using coordinated smokes and flashes to execute successfully. Positioning is paramount, especially in areas like A Site Balcony and B Site Van, where elevated spots can provide significant advantages in firefights. To enhance your game on Mirage, consider these strategies:
- Mid Control: Gain control of Mid early in the round to open up multiple play options.
- A Site Executes: Use smokes and flashes to blind defenders and take control of the site rapidly.
